📈 Magnificent Seven Stocks Plunge 14.9% ($2.63T) in Q1 2025, Hitting Six-Month Low

The combined market capitalization of the Magnificent Seven—Apple, Microsoft, Nvidia, Alphabet, Amazon, Meta Platforms, and Tesla—fell to $15.0 trillion as of March 31, 2025, marking its lowest level since September 10, 2024. The group lost $2.63 trillion in value during the first quarter of 2025, with Tesla, Nvidia, and Alphabet leading the declines.
Market Cap Decline in Q1 2025:
· Tesla: -35.7% (-$460B)
· Nvidia: -19.6% (-$640B)
· Alphabet: -18.3% (-$430B)
· Amazon: -12.6% (-$290B)
· Apple: -11.9% (-$450B)
· Microsoft: -10.9% (-$340B)
· Meta: -1.2% (-$20B)
